MusicPlayer:AndroidBindingDemo 1.01

Licencji: Bezpłatna wersja próbna ‎Rozmiar pliku: 48.23 MB
‎Ocena użytkowników: 4.0/5 - ‎1 ‎Głosów

O MusicPlayer:AndroidBindingDemo

* Jest to techniczne demo przeznaczone tylko dla programistów Androida *

Jest to demonstracja dla powiązania lista obiektów w android binding, MVVM przyjazne framework.

* Najważniejsze funkcje *

* Zadeklarować powiązanie widoku w plikach XML układu. Nie są potrzebne żadne dodatkowe pliki. * Pomaga wdraża MVVM * Znacznie łatwiejsze do testowania jednostek * Sprawdzanie poprawności modelu, który sprawdza poprawność względem ViewModel * Obsługa wyników kursora, a nawet sprawdzić poprawność wyniku kursora!

Wprowadzenie

Podstawową jednostką dla tworzenia aplikacji systemu Android jest działanie. Jednak sposób, w jaki projekt SDK systemu Android jest przeciążanie działania dość mocno. Jest to miejsce do kontrolowania przepływu aplikacji, obsługi danych wejściowych użytkownika, komunikowania się z warstwą danych, warstwą usług itp.

Android-Binding jest MVVM (Model-View-ViewModel) framework, który pomaga zwalnianie działania z pracy bezpośrednio do interfejsów użytkownika. Jako działanie, to zadanie jest tylko do dostarczania ViewModel, który Widok wymaga renderowania wynik, podczas gdy ViewModel jest klasą, która z zerowym bezpośredniego sprzężenia z widoku (i faktycznie może dostarczyć inny Widok do niego).

Przez oddzielenie view (interfejs użytkownika) logiki i interakcji z ViewModel, pomaga również w jednostki testowania logiki aplikacji.

* Kod źródłowy dostępny na stronie projektu, w sekcji Demos.

Aby uzyskać więcej informacji na temat powiązania z listami: http://code.google.com/p/android-binding/wiki/BindingListOfObjects

Strona główna projektu: http://code.google.com/p/android-binding/